Senior Software Developer

CANARIE Inc.

📍 Ottawa, ON, Canada

Full-time Other-General Posted February 17, 2026

Job Description

CANARIE has an immediate opening for a Senior Software Developer. This role will be accountable for designing, developing, deploying, and maintaining secure, scalable software solutions that support the company’s network orchestration and cybersecurity initiatives.

This is a new full-time, term position through December 31, 2026, reporting to CANARIE’s Manager, Software Development.

The salary range for this role is between $125,000 to $162,000.

Key Responsibilities

  • Design and develop secure, scalable software for network orchestration and cybersecurity tooling in support of Canada’s Research and Education network
  • Deliver full stack solutions using Python, Django, Angular, Docker, and Kubernetes
  • Apply DevOps, CI/CD, and Agile (SCRUM) methodologies
  • Guide technical best practices and mentor junior developers
  • Research and evaluate new technologies relevant to networking and security
  • Integrate LLMs and agent...